Jerry Garcia's first solo album in over four years and the final studio release featuring the classic lineup of the Jerry Garcia Band, 1982's RUN FOR THE ROSES was the initial indication that Garcia was struggling to find his way out of the drugs and depression that had left the Grateful Dead so inert for the preceding few years. The gently loping title track, a Robert Hunter lyric built on the interplay between Garcia's guitar and weary, bluesy vocals and Melvin Seals's soulful organ fills, is one of the highlights of Garcia's entire extracurricular musical career. Another standout track is the heartfelt, country-tinged cover of Bob Dylan's "Knockin' on Heaven's Door," which would go on to become a favorite Garcia cover. Although the Dead would not fully break out of their creative rut until 1987's IN THE DARK, the defiantly old-school, mellow, and rootsy RUN FOR THE ROSES shows that even in a personal slump, Garcia was still capable of greatness.
